The mainstream media in Europe only just now found out about it?

It was reported over two or three weeks ago in a long article in the (US) Wall Street Journal. It featured a design engineer and his problems with the production of certain plastic parts, and his responsibility for a specific amount of weight reduction. It seems that the new production process is a challenge to the factory workers.
